在现代数据管理与分析的场景中,数据安全与隐私保护成为了企业关注的核心问题之一。特别是在数据中台、数字孪生以及数字可视化等领域,如何有效地控制数据访问权限,确保敏感信息不被未经授权的用户访问,成为了技术实现中的重要挑战。Ranger作为一个开源的统一数据权限管理框架,提供了强大的数据访问控制能力,而其中字段隐藏技术则是实现数据安全的重要手段之一。本文将深入探讨Ranger框架下如何实现字段级别的隐藏技术,为企业用户和技术开发者提供详细的技术参考。
随着企业数字化转型的深入推进,数据已经成为企业的重要资产。然而,数据的开放性和共享性也带来了安全隐患,特别是在处理敏感信息时,如何在不影响正常业务流程的情况下,隐藏或脱敏敏感字段,成为了数据安全领域的重要课题。Ranger作为一个功能强大的数据权限管理框架,提供了灵活的配置和扩展能力,能够帮助企业实现字段级别的隐藏与脱敏。
Ranger是Apache软件基金会下的一个开源项目,专注于数据安全和访问控制。它提供了一个统一的平台,用于管理企业中的数据权限,支持多种数据存储类型,包括Hadoop HDFS、Hive、HBase、MySQL、Oracle等。Ranger通过策略配置,能够实现基于角色的访问控制(RBAC)和基于属性的访问控制(PBAC),从而帮助企业构建安全的数据管理系统。
在Ranger框架中,字段隐藏技术是通过数据脱敏和动态权限控制来实现的。字段隐藏的目标是在数据展示或查询结果中,自动隐藏或脱敏敏感字段,确保只有授权用户能够看到或访问这些数据。这种技术在数据可视化、报表生成以及数据分析等场景中具有重要的应用价值。
在Ranger中,字段隐藏技术主要通过以下几种方式实现:
数据脱敏是通过技术手段对敏感数据进行处理,使其在不改变数据结构的前提下,失去可读性或关联性。常见的脱敏方法包括:
在Ranger中,数据脱敏可以通过预处理或实时处理的方式实现。预处理脱敏适用于需要长期隐藏的字段,而实时脱敏则适用于需要动态控制的场景。
Ranger通过动态权限控制,能够根据用户的角色和权限,实时决定哪些字段可以被访问或展示。这种控制机制可以通过以下方式实现:
通过动态权限控制,Ranger能够实现细粒度的字段管理,确保敏感信息不会被未经授权的用户访问。
Ranger支持在字段级别进行权限配置,这意味着可以针对每个字段单独设置访问策略。例如,在一个包含多个字段的表中,可以为每个字段配置不同的访问权限,从而实现字段级别的隐藏或脱敏。
这种细粒度的控制机制特别适合需要处理多类型数据的企业场景。例如,在医疗数据中,可能需要隐藏患者的姓名、地址等敏感信息;在金融数据中,则需要隐藏信用卡号、交易密码等关键信息。
字段隐藏技术在多个场景中具有广泛的应用,以下是一些典型的应用案例:
在数据可视化平台中,用户通常需要查看各种数据报表和图表。然而,这些数据中可能包含敏感信息,例如客户信息、财务数据等。通过Ranger的字段隐藏技术,可以在可视化界面中自动隐藏或脱敏敏感字段,确保只有授权用户能够看到完整数据。
数据中台是企业数据资产的重要枢纽,负责数据的存储、处理和分发。在数据中台中,通过Ranger的字段隐藏技术,可以对敏感数据进行脱敏或隐藏,确保在数据分发过程中不会泄露敏感信息。
数字孪生系统通过实时数据模拟物理世界的状态,广泛应用于智能制造、智慧城市等领域。在数字孪生系统中,通过Ranger的字段隐藏技术,可以对敏感数据进行处理,确保在数据展示和分析过程中不会泄露关键信息。
为了在Ranger框架下实现字段隐藏,企业需要按照以下步骤进行操作:
首先,企业需要安装并配置Ranger框架。Ranger支持多种数据存储类型,因此需要根据企业的数据存储环境选择合适的安装方式。安装完成后,需要对Ranger进行基本配置,包括用户管理、角色管理以及数据存储配置。
接下来,企业需要配置数据脱敏策略。在Ranger中,可以通过预处理或实时处理的方式实现数据脱敏。预处理脱敏适用于需要长期隐藏的字段,而实时脱敏则适用于需要动态控制的场景。
以随机替换为例,企业可以配置Ranger将身份证号的中间几位替换为随机数字。同样,企业也可以配置模糊化处理或加密方式,以满足不同的脱敏需求。
在配置动态权限控制时,企业需要根据用户的角色和属性,设置字段的访问权限。例如,普通用户只能查看非敏感字段,而管理员则可以查看所有字段。企业可以通过基于角色的访问控制(RBAC)或基于属性的访问控制(PBAC)实现这一目标。
最后,企业需要在字段级别进行权限配置,确保每个字段的访问权限独立可控。例如,在一个包含多个字段的表中,可以为每个字段配置不同的访问策略,从而实现字段级别的隐藏或脱敏。
通过以上步骤,企业可以利用Ranger框架实现字段级别的隐藏与脱敏,确保敏感信息的安全性。
与传统的数据安全管理方式相比,Ranger的字段隐藏技术具有以下优势:
在实际应用中,企业可能需要选择适合的企业级工具来实现Ranger框架下的字段隐藏技术。以下是一些推荐的工具与平台:
无论选择哪种工具,企业都需要根据自身的实际需求进行评估和选择,确保能够满足数据安全管理的目标。
通过本文的介绍,企业可以深入了解Ranger框架下实现字段隐藏技术的方法和步骤,为构建安全可靠的数据管理系统提供有力的技术支持。
如果您对Ranger框架或数据安全管理感兴趣,可以访问某大数据平台了解更多相关信息,或申请试用(申请试用)以体验其实用功能。
申请试用&下载资料